首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android Studio App Inspector的问题

Android Studio App Inspector是一款用于分析和调试Android应用程序的工具。它提供了一系列功能和特性,帮助开发人员诊断和解决应用程序中的问题。

Android Studio App Inspector的主要功能包括:

  1. 应用程序性能分析:可以监测应用程序的CPU使用率、内存占用、网络请求等性能指标,帮助开发人员找到性能瓶颈并进行优化。
  2. 布局查看器:可以查看和编辑应用程序的布局文件,包括XML布局和布局属性,以便对UI进行调整和优化。
  3. 应用程序数据查看器:可以查看和编辑应用程序中的数据库、共享首选项和文件系统,方便开发人员进行数据调试和修改。
  4. 网络监测工具:可以拦截和查看应用程序的网络请求和响应,包括请求头、响应内容等信息,方便开发人员进行网络调试和安全性分析。
  5. 代码分析工具:可以对应用程序的代码进行静态分析,发现潜在的bug、代码规范违规等问题,并提供修复建议。
  6. 内存分析器:可以监测应用程序的内存使用情况,包括内存泄漏、对象分配等问题,并提供相关的分析报告和建议。
  7. 应用程序安全分析:可以检测应用程序的安全漏洞,包括敏感信息泄露、未加密的网络通信等问题,并提供修复建议。

Android Studio App Inspector可以广泛应用于Android应用程序的开发、测试和维护过程中。开发人员可以利用其强大的功能和特性,提高应用程序的性能、稳定性和安全性。

腾讯云提供了一系列与Android开发相关的产品和服务,例如:

  1. 腾讯移动分析:https://cloud.tencent.com/product/mna 腾讯移动分析是一款用于分析和监测移动应用程序的产品,提供了用户行为分析、性能监控、错误分析等功能,帮助开发人员了解应用程序的使用情况和性能状况。
  2. 腾讯云移动开发平台:https://cloud.tencent.com/product/campus 腾讯云移动开发平台提供了一站式的移动应用开发工具和服务,包括云端IDE、测试工具、推送服务等,方便开发人员进行Android应用程序的开发和调试。

以上是关于Android Studio App Inspector的简要介绍和相关腾讯云产品的推荐。如需了解更多详细信息,建议访问腾讯云官方网站进行查阅。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Android Studio 4.0 新功能中Live Layout Inspector详解

最近 Android Studio 4.0 稳定版本正式发布,其中一个重要升级就是新版Layout Inspector 旧版Layout Inspector 4.0 之前我们通过Tools - Android...Live Layout Inspector 4.0 通过同样菜单可以打开新版 Layout Inspector ? 运行APP后,选择当前进程,可以看到当前运行中画面: ?...3D View Live Layout Inspector 可以3D形式显示Hierarchy,更利于开发者分析层次结构,(3D View 目前只能用于Api Level 29以上app中) ?...Resource Properties Live Layout Inspector 属性信息相对于老版本更加强大,通过资源超链接,可以直接跳往Res文件: ?...总结 到此这篇关于Android Studio 4.0 新功能之Live Layout Inspector文章就介绍到这了,更多相关Android Studio 4.0 新功能之Live Layout

1.4K41
  • App工程从Eclipse迁移到Android Studio问题总结

    这段时间把一个App工程从原来ADT环境(即Eclipse)迁移到Android Studio环境,发现并处理了一系列迁移问题,兹记录如下。...把ADT工程迁移到AS,通常做法是打开Android Studio,依次选择菜单“File”——“New”——“Import Module”,然后点击窗口右边浏览按钮选择ADT工程路径,点击“Finish...”按钮,等待Android Studio识别并导入ADT工程。...转换代码文件格式 注意Android Studio对文件格式校验要比Eclipse严格,不符合AS要求文件格式将导致编译错误,下面是两种常见问题格式: 1、JAVA代码文件为ASCII编码,编译时报错...,则表示这个App工程包括所有jar在内方法总数太多了,超过了一个dex文件允许65536上限个数。

    1.6K30

    Android StudioAPP目录结构详解

    Android Studio工程目录 ? 1、.gradle和.idea 这两个目录下放置都是Android Studio自动生成一些文件,我们无须关心,也不要去手动编辑。...Android Studio默认没有启动gradle wrapper方式,如果需要打开,可以点击Android Studio导航栏 – File – Settings – Build,Execution...9、HelloWorld.iml iml文件是所有IntelliJ IDEA项目都会自动生成一个文件(Android Studio是基于IntelliJ IDEA开发),用于标识这是一个IntelliJ...app目录结构 除了app目录之外,大多数文件和目录都是自动生成不需要我们进行修改,下面我们详细介绍app目录结构。 ?...总结 到此这篇关于Android StudioAPP目录结构详解文章就介绍到这了,更多相关android studio APP目录结构内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持

    2.2K11

    2.Andriod Studio结合Visual Studio Emulator for Android调试Android App

    说到开发就绕不开调试程序,调试Android App我们有2种选择,真机调试和模拟器调试:真机调试相对简单,就不做介绍了,还有一方面原因是由于安卓手机一旦插到电脑上,开始ADB调试后,各种流氓软件净是往手机上装垃圾应用...Visual Studio Emulator for Android官方介绍页面。 配置Android Studio官方博客(本博客大部分参考资料来源于此)。...为Android Studio添加启动模拟器快捷按钮 虽然在Visual Studio Emulator for Android管理器窗口中可以启动模拟器,但是每次都要到这里面去打开还是比较繁琐,...故而我们为Android Studio添加一个启动Visual Studio  Emulator for Android快捷按钮。...用Visual Studio Emulator for Android调试Android App 按下Run按钮(绿色箭头那个...),弹出选择Android设备选择框: ?

    2.1K50

    android studio遇到问题(记录总结)

    SDK 无法更新解决方案 这个问题不是Android Studio问题,而且由一些一些众所周知原因导致,我们这里说下解决办法。...首先,找到你hosts文件,不同平台下(Windows,Mac,Lunix)这个文件所在路径不一样, 分别如下: Windows:C:\WINDOWS\system32\drivers\etc Mac...Android Studio 中文乱码解决方法 很多同学都安装了Android Studio,但是发现中文是乱码,其实这个很好解决。...在打开窗口中,找到IDE Settings下Appearance,在右侧勾选上“Override default fonts by”,然后在第一个下拉框中选择字体为“simsun”,然后apply,...Android Studio无法得知改动代码是不是在程序初始化时候才执行,而我们却可以知道,所以确保你理解了Rerun这个按钮作用,并在恰当时机使用它。 点红色停止按钮  未完待续。。。

    1.3K130

    android studio遇到问题(记录总结)

    SDK 无法更新解决方案 这个问题不是Android Studio问题,而且由一些一些众所周知原因导致,我们这里说下解决办法。...首先,找到你hosts文件,不同平台下(Windows,Mac,Lunix)这个文件所在路径不一样, 分别如下: Windows:C:\WINDOWS\system32\drivers\etc Mac...---- Android Studio 中文乱码解决方法 很多同学都安装了Android Studio,但是发现中文是乱码,其实这个很好解决。...在打开窗口中,找到IDE Settings下Appearance,在右侧勾选上“Override default fonts by”,然后在第一个下拉框中选择字体为“simsun”,然后apply,...Android Studio无法得知改动代码是不是在程序初始化时候才执行,而我们却可以知道,所以确保你理解了Rerun这个按钮作用,并在恰当时机使用它。 点红色停止按钮 未完待续。。。

    62510

    使用Android Studio实现为系统级app签名

    我们在做系统级app开发时,往往会在AndroidManifest.xml文件中添加:android:sharedUserId=”android.uid.system”以获取系统级权限,如果你正在使用...Android Studio进行开发,编译生成apk会因为签名问题无法安装。...studio 生成自己jks文件 打开新建key界面: build- Generate Signed APK… 填写jks路径、密码、别名等信息,点击OK生成jks文件 ?...别名] 四、配置gradle文件使用签名文件 配置build.gradle文件(Module:app),在Android{}代码块中添加如下代码: signingConfigs { release...以上这篇使用Android Studio实现为系统级app签名就是小编分享给大家全部内容了,希望能给大家一个参考。

    2.4K30

    基于 Android Studio 音乐播放器App

    项目源码获取: 点击右侧文字传送:基于 Android Studio 实现简易 音乐播放器App_android studio音乐播放器-CSDN博客 一、项目运行视频演示 二、项目开发环境介绍 三、.../android" xmlns:app="http://schemas.android.com/apk/res-auto" xmlns:tools="http://schemas.android.com...总体而言,这段代码实现了基本用户登录功能,包括输入验证、数据库查询、界面跳转和提示信息显示,是一个典型 Android 应用程序中常见登录功能实现。...总体而言,这段代码实现了基本用户注册功能,包括输入验证、数据库插入操作、界面跳转和提示信息显示,是一个典型 Android 应用程序中常见注册功能实现。...总体而言,这段代码实现了一个简单主界面管理,使用了 Fragment 技术来管理不同界面内容,这是在 Android 应用开发中常见做法,能够帮助实现界面的模块化和复用。 <?

    11310

    Android Studio实现简单计算器APP

    一、简介:用Android Studio实现一个简单计算器APP,并在蓝叠模拟器中运行。 该计算器只能实现两位数字四则运算。 二、代码 activity_main.xml —界面设计 <?...(" ")); // 运算符 String op = str1.substring(str1.indexOf(" ")+1,str1.indexOf(" ")+2); // 第二个数字符串 String...测试结果: 1.可以计算简单两位数四则运算,但是如果计算超过2位数运算,则会出现异常使程序退出。...四、总结 总的来说,这个计算器确实十分简单,功能也不完善,还有很多小bug,但是对于刚入门菜鸟来说,也用了不少时间。希望自己能更加努力地坚持学习下去!...更多计算器功能实现,请点击专题: 计算器功能汇总 进行学习 关于Android计算器功能实现,查看专题:Android计算器 进行学习。 以上就是本文全部内容,希望对大家学习有所帮助。

    1.4K30

    android studio flutter代理设置问题

    前提 初次安装flutter,通过代理设置加快速度安装首次更新数据,但在添加设备并开始打包编译时出现classpath找不到情况 1.在初次启动IDE时候会提示更新各种SDK包,此时一般会直接设置代理...,我系统时Ubuntu18.04,所以直接代理了本地vpn,127.0.0.1 端口1080 2.在编译打包时候出现了找不到相关包,原因是flutter三个默认配置地方采用了Google路径包...切换maven包源为国内阿里源 在android/build.gradle下都换为 // google() // jcenter() maven { url 'https:...maven { url 'http://maven.aliyun.com/nexus/content/groups/public' } 关闭IDE全局代理 : 设置->搜索proxy 关闭由于IDE自己生成本地全局代理...(这里才是IDE内部最终代理使用配置) 我本地路径: vim .gradle/gradle.properties 注释所有代理项和端口 systemProp.https.nonProxyHosts=192.168

    2.3K10

    Crack App | Android Studio Xposed 开发环境搭建

    Xposed 开发环境搭建 创建一个 app 添加 meta 创建 app 项目之后,在AndroidStudio创建一个android应用后,在AndroidManifest.xml里添加以下内容...; import de.robv.android.xposed.XC_MethodHook; import de.robv.android.xposed.XposedBridge; import de.robv.android.xposed.XposedHelpers...XC_LoadPackage.LoadPackageParam loadPackageParam) throws Throwable { XposedBridge.log("Loaded app...:" + loadPackageParam.packageName ); } } 指定模块入口 在src/main下创建assets目录 在这个文件夹下创建xposed_init文件...将我们上一步创建入口类完整类名写入 这样就完成了 xposed 模块开发基础环境搭建 接下来就可以按照你自己需求开发对应 xposed 项目了 注意事项 1、在build.gradle里把

    1.3K20
    领券